This was our fifth fly in , last Year we had 15 Power Parachutes at the event, this year we had close to same as last year. This year we had, 4 – Air Wolfs with Rotax 912 engines, 5 – Summits, 2 – Buckeyes, 1- Hornet, 1 – Pegasus, 1 – Six Chuter. We had Campers hooked up to RV parking, with Pilots coming in from Ontario through to Alberta, great times with good friends. This turned out to be a bit of a swap meet for Power Parachutes, from planes to regulators, to chutes, there was allot of swapping and selling, it was fun to watch. On Friday, morning we had an update from Transport Canada on the regulations for expired student pilot permits. Expired means you have No valid license, no insurance (even if you purchased 3 rd
party liability, it is not valid if your license is expired). On Saturday we could not fly due to higher winds than we like to fly in, so we helped each other repair, and update PPCs, as well as do some wing inspections. “Wow”, we had one individual who had a 20 plus year old wing (it had no tags on it, so he did not know the exact year of manufacturing of his wing, or the MTOW) of his wing. So we all took part in measuring its porosity with a porosity meter, ( a new wing is over 3500 seconds, a poor wing is ~700 seconds, well his measured “25 seconds” another words there is no way it could fly safely, he scraped it on the spot. But another pilot had a spare used wing that measured over 2000 seconds, with the proper tag on the wing, so he purchased that one. It was all about helping one another learn and be safe this year and a good time visiting.
